Technical bids by gas-based power plants seeking PSDF (Power System Development Fund) support for using imported natural gas were opened on May 8, paving the way for the financial round of the auction to being from May 11.

A total of 54 gas-based plants are eligible to participate in the technical bid stage which is being held under two categories – 23 that are receiving some domestic gas and 31 that are completely stranded.

The plants belong to companies such as Lanco, GMR, GVK, Reliance Power, Tata Power Delhi Distribution Ltd, Essar Power and others. It is not immediately known whether these companies have submitted technical bids.

After the opening of the bids, the participants will be informed of the delivered price of the imported natural gas. Based on this, they would be able to make a decision of whether to participate in the financial stage or not.
